Sycamore
Sycamore is a hamlet in Williamson, Tennessee. Sycamore is situated nearby to the hamlet Burwood, as well as near Boston.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Burwood and Boston.

Boston
Hamlet
Boston is an unincorporated community in Williamson County, Tennessee. Boston is 10.8 miles west-southwest of Franklin. The Sparkman-Skelley Farm, which is listed on the National Register of Historic Places, is located in Boston. Boston is situated 2½ miles northwest of Sycamore.
Spring Hill
Town
Photo: Skyrunner75,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Spring Hill is a city in Maury and Williamson counties in the U.S. state of Tennessee, located approximately 30 miles south of Nashville. Its population as of 2024 is 59,398. Spring Hill is situated 6 miles southeast of Sycamore.
